Music plays as Jesse speaks, then fades out. 00:00:21 Jesse Thorn Host It’s Bullseye. I’m Jesse Thorn. Have you seen Ramy? It’s a show on Hulu. It wrapped up its second season a few months back. It focuses on a guy named Ramy, played by our guest—Ramy Youssef. When the show kicks off, Ramy is in his late ‘20s. Living with his parents in New Jersey. At different times, Ramy wonders what to do about his career; about his love life; his family life—all stuff that’s pretty typical for someone his age. One of the things that makes Ramy the show unique, though, is how it talks about faith. Ramy the character is a practicing Muslim. His relationship with religion is more than just, y’know, like a thing his parents do. [Music fades out entirely.] He prays. He goes to a mosque. He doesn’t drink. Amid the Millennial existential angst and jokes about sex, the show also asks some probing, deep questions about faith. Recently, Ramy was nominate for three Emmys: Best Directing in a Comedy; Best Supporting Actor for the great Mahershala Ali; and Best Actor for Ramy Youssef. -

Global Posts building CUNY Communities since 2009 http://tags.commons.gc.cuny.edu “Persian Like The Cat”: Crossing Borders with The Axis of Evil Comedy Tour Tamara L. Smith/ In the wake of the attacks of September 11, Americans of Middle Eastern heritage experienced a sudden and dramatic change in how their ethnicities were perceived. As comedian and activist Dean Obeidallah explained, “On September 10, I went to bed white, and woke up Arab.”[1] Once comfortable in their American identities, they now had to contend with new cultural forces that configured them as dangerous outsiders. In the months and years that followed, the supposed existence of a so-called “Axis of Evil” of dangerous, anti-American regimes became the justification for expanding military operations abroad, while domestically it fed into a growing Orientalist sentiment that continues to configure Americans of Middle Eastern descent as potentially dangerous outsiders. In 2005, a group of United States comedians of Middle Eastern heritage adopted the alarmist moniker as a tongue-in-cheek title for their stand-up comedy performances. Part commiseration and part public relations, the Axis of Evil Comedy Tour served both as an expression of solidarity between Middle Eastern-Americans and as an act of cultural diplomacy, recasting Middle Eastern ethnic identities as familiar, patriotic, and safe. In this article, I look back to a 2006 performance by the Axis of Evil Comedy Tour in Santa Ana, California, including sets by tour members Ahmed Ahmed, Maz Jobrani, and Aron Kader as well as their guest, New York Arab-American Comedy Festival founder Dean Obeidallah. -

Received: 3 January 2014; in revised form: 19 May 2014 / Accepted: 20 May 2014 / Published: 1210 June 2014 Abstract: This article explores several key events in the last 12 years that led to periods of heightened suspicion about Islam and Muslims in the United States. It provides a brief overview of the rise of anti-Muslim and anti-Islam sentiment known as “Islamophobia”, and it investigates claims that American Muslims cannot be trusted to be loyal to the United States because of their religion. This research examines American Muslim perspectives on national security discourse regarding terrorism and radicalization, both domestic and foreign, after 9/11. The article argues that it is important to highlight developments, both progressive and conservative, in Muslim communities in the United States over the last 12 years that belie suspicions of widespread anti-American sentiment among Muslims or questions about the loyalty of American Muslims. The article concludes with a discussion of important shifts from a Muslim identity politics that disassociated from American identity and ‘American exceptionalism’ to a position of integration and cultural assimilation. -
